基于AD9858的雷達信號波形產生器設計
發布時間:2008/6/24 0:00:00 訪問次數:635
1 引言
近年來,隨著雷達技術的高速發展對雷達信號源的要求也越來越高。寬工作頻段、高輸出功率、復雜多變的信號調制形式和信號的穩定度已成為衡量雷達信號源性能的重要指標。ad9858是業界首款具有1 gs/s直接數字合成器(dds),10位d/a轉換器,快速頻率跳躍和精細調諧分辨率功能的單片解決方案,ad9858優良的性能使其適用于軍事以及航空雷達的信號源設計。
2 雷達信號波形產生器
雷達信號波形產生器在有源雷達整體結構中占有重要地位,能在低功率電平上產生雷達信號的基本波形,因而易于得到脈沖壓縮和相參系統等所要求的復雜波形。基本波形經過功率放大器后即可送至天線作為雷達輸出信號。圖1所示為采用功率放大發射機和超外差接收機雷達的簡化框圖。
雷達系統普遍采用的發射信號大斂分為:單頻脈沖、線性調頻信號及編碼調制信號。為了增大探測距離,優化距離分辨率、速度分辨率等技術指標,通常可將這些信號組合來形成波形。采用高速dds器件ad9858形成的波形信號具有高精度、高掃描率、抗干擾性好、截獲率低等特性,而且硬件電路結構簡單,有助于設備的小型化和集成化。
3 dds工作原理
3.1 dds基本原理
直接數字頻率合成(dds)采用全數字結構,具有精確的頻率分辨率、快速的頻率轉換時間以及可靈活產生多種信號等特點。因此,dds已逐漸取代模擬方式。
dds由相位累加器、波形存儲器和數模轉換器等組成。其原理:向dds寫入頻率控制字,經過相位累加器轉換成瞬時相位,在外部參考時鐘作用下,每個時鐘周期相位累加器累加相位步進一次,然后對應到波形存儲器中所存儲的正弦函數查詢表,不同的瞬時相位碼輸出不同的幅值編碼,再將該幅值編碼輸出給數模轉換器(d/a),把數字量轉換為模擬量輸出給低通濾波器,最后輸出所需的信號。
3.2 ad9858簡介
與其他高速dds器件相比,ad9858內部集成有10位數模轉換器,其頻率分辨率為32位,最高輸出頻率可達400 mhz。ad9858的系統結構含有:dds模塊、模擬混頻器模塊和數字鎖相環模塊。其中dds模塊可在數字域產生表示正弦曲線的數字值;數字鎖相環由數字相頻檢測器(phd)和具有高速鎖存邏輯電路的電荷泵組成;模擬混頻器主要用于通信基站設計。
ad9858有并行和串行兩種數據傳輸方式。數據從用戶傳輸到dds器件需兩步驟:寫操作時,不管是采用并行還是串行數據傳輸方式,首先都要將數據寫入i/o緩沖;當數據從i/o緩沖器存入存儲寄存器,dds才開始接收數據。在ad9858中,觸發fud引腳或者改變預編程的profile都可以使i/o緩沖器中的數據存入dds的存儲寄存器中。
并行模式時,系統激活8個雙向數據口(dc~d7)、6個地址輸人口(addr5~addr0)、1個讀口(rd)和1個寫口(wr)。寄存器的選取由寄存器提供的地址決定。讀寫功能由rd和wr脈沖觸發控制,但這兩個功能不能同時作用。讀寫數據通過。d0~d7引腳傳輸。
串行模式包括兩個階段。第一階段由一個8位的指令周期構成,最高位是標志位,可確定讀寫操作,低6位是串行數據傳輸目標寄存器地址;第二階段是將數據寫入寄存器。
4 系統軟件設計
雷達信號發生器是在vc環境下通過計算機并口控制ad9858,來產生雷達發射機所需的各種信號。ad9858有單頻、頻率掃描和睡眠三種工作模式。可產生單頻點正弦信號、chirp信號、bpsk(qpsk)信號。
線性調頻工作原理:先指定頻率起始點和步進頻率,并使頻率以一定的速率累加,直到用戶所設定的上限頻率(最高頻率為參考時鐘頻率的一半,即奈奎斯特頻率)。以ad9858采用串行工作方式,產生線性調頻信號為例,初始化是指復位ad9858的初始狀態,包括設置s/p select,sleep,reset,clr,sync等位。根據產生信號參數分別配置控制寄存器(cfr)、頻率調節字(ftw)、步進頻率調節字(dftw)、步進頻率斜率控制字(dfrrw)和相位偏移字(pow)等。
寄存器設置完成,系統等待外部激勵信號。當檢測到一個上升沿后,系統發出update信號,將寫入寄存器的數據導入dds內核,dds按照新配置開始工作。與此同時,計數器開始計數,并輸出線性調頻信號,并使相位累加器置1。計數器溢出后,系統發出update信號,由于此時相位累加器清零位有效,相位累加器被清零,同時停止輸出線性調頻信號。其中,寫控制字以及update信號的產生都是通過計算機并口實現的。在vc環境下,為方便對并口實施讀寫操作,本系統設計直接使用由yariv kaplan編寫的winio庫,具有如下特點:winio庫通過使用內核模式下設備驅動程序和其他一些底層編程技巧繞過windows安全保護機制,允許32位windows程序直接操作i/o口。庫內含有getportval和set-portval兩函數即可實現并口數據讀寫。
5 系統硬件設計
雷達信號波形產生器基于vc軟件編程環境,采用計算機向并行接口讀寫數據來控制ad9858,再輔以晶體振蕩器、濾波器、放大器和混頻器等外圍
1 引言
近年來,隨著雷達技術的高速發展對雷達信號源的要求也越來越高。寬工作頻段、高輸出功率、復雜多變的信號調制形式和信號的穩定度已成為衡量雷達信號源性能的重要指標。ad9858是業界首款具有1 gs/s直接數字合成器(dds),10位d/a轉換器,快速頻率跳躍和精細調諧分辨率功能的單片解決方案,ad9858優良的性能使其適用于軍事以及航空雷達的信號源設計。
2 雷達信號波形產生器
雷達信號波形產生器在有源雷達整體結構中占有重要地位,能在低功率電平上產生雷達信號的基本波形,因而易于得到脈沖壓縮和相參系統等所要求的復雜波形。基本波形經過功率放大器后即可送至天線作為雷達輸出信號。圖1所示為采用功率放大發射機和超外差接收機雷達的簡化框圖。
雷達系統普遍采用的發射信號大斂分為:單頻脈沖、線性調頻信號及編碼調制信號。為了增大探測距離,優化距離分辨率、速度分辨率等技術指標,通常可將這些信號組合來形成波形。采用高速dds器件ad9858形成的波形信號具有高精度、高掃描率、抗干擾性好、截獲率低等特性,而且硬件電路結構簡單,有助于設備的小型化和集成化。
3 dds工作原理
3.1 dds基本原理
直接數字頻率合成(dds)采用全數字結構,具有精確的頻率分辨率、快速的頻率轉換時間以及可靈活產生多種信號等特點。因此,dds已逐漸取代模擬方式。
dds由相位累加器、波形存儲器和數模轉換器等組成。其原理:向dds寫入頻率控制字,經過相位累加器轉換成瞬時相位,在外部參考時鐘作用下,每個時鐘周期相位累加器累加相位步進一次,然后對應到波形存儲器中所存儲的正弦函數查詢表,不同的瞬時相位碼輸出不同的幅值編碼,再將該幅值編碼輸出給數模轉換器(d/a),把數字量轉換為模擬量輸出給低通濾波器,最后輸出所需的信號。
3.2 ad9858簡介
與其他高速dds器件相比,ad9858內部集成有10位數模轉換器,其頻率分辨率為32位,最高輸出頻率可達400 mhz。ad9858的系統結構含有:dds模塊、模擬混頻器模塊和數字鎖相環模塊。其中dds模塊可在數字域產生表示正弦曲線的數字值;數字鎖相環由數字相頻檢測器(phd)和具有高速鎖存邏輯電路的電荷泵組成;模擬混頻器主要用于通信基站設計。
ad9858有并行和串行兩種數據傳輸方式。數據從用戶傳輸到dds器件需兩步驟:寫操作時,不管是采用并行還是串行數據傳輸方式,首先都要將數據寫入i/o緩沖;當數據從i/o緩沖器存入存儲寄存器,dds才開始接收數據。在ad9858中,觸發fud引腳或者改變預編程的profile都可以使i/o緩沖器中的數據存入dds的存儲寄存器中。
并行模式時,系統激活8個雙向數據口(dc~d7)、6個地址輸人口(addr5~addr0)、1個讀口(rd)和1個寫口(wr)。寄存器的選取由寄存器提供的地址決定。讀寫功能由rd和wr脈沖觸發控制,但這兩個功能不能同時作用。讀寫數據通過。d0~d7引腳傳輸。
串行模式包括兩個階段。第一階段由一個8位的指令周期構成,最高位是標志位,可確定讀寫操作,低6位是串行數據傳輸目標寄存器地址;第二階段是將數據寫入寄存器。
4 系統軟件設計
雷達信號發生器是在vc環境下通過計算機并口控制ad9858,來產生雷達發射機所需的各種信號。ad9858有單頻、頻率掃描和睡眠三種工作模式。可產生單頻點正弦信號、chirp信號、bpsk(qpsk)信號。
線性調頻工作原理:先指定頻率起始點和步進頻率,并使頻率以一定的速率累加,直到用戶所設定的上限頻率(最高頻率為參考時鐘頻率的一半,即奈奎斯特頻率)。以ad9858采用串行工作方式,產生線性調頻信號為例,初始化是指復位ad9858的初始狀態,包括設置s/p select,sleep,reset,clr,sync等位。根據產生信號參數分別配置控制寄存器(cfr)、頻率調節字(ftw)、步進頻率調節字(dftw)、步進頻率斜率控制字(dfrrw)和相位偏移字(pow)等。
寄存器設置完成,系統等待外部激勵信號。當檢測到一個上升沿后,系統發出update信號,將寫入寄存器的數據導入dds內核,dds按照新配置開始工作。與此同時,計數器開始計數,并輸出線性調頻信號,并使相位累加器置1。計數器溢出后,系統發出update信號,由于此時相位累加器清零位有效,相位累加器被清零,同時停止輸出線性調頻信號。其中,寫控制字以及update信號的產生都是通過計算機并口實現的。在vc環境下,為方便對并口實施讀寫操作,本系統設計直接使用由yariv kaplan編寫的winio庫,具有如下特點:winio庫通過使用內核模式下設備驅動程序和其他一些底層編程技巧繞過windows安全保護機制,允許32位windows程序直接操作i/o口。庫內含有getportval和set-portval兩函數即可實現并口數據讀寫。
5 系統硬件設計
雷達信號波形產生器基于vc軟件編程環境,采用計算機向并行接口讀寫數據來控制ad9858,再輔以晶體振蕩器、濾波器、放大器和混頻器等外圍
熱門點擊
- TI推出新型+/-10V 16位SAR模數轉
- GE Fanuc 智能平臺發布高速模擬-數字
- 基于AD9858的雷達信號波形產生器設計
- 德州儀器新推出兩款多通道16位△∑型模數轉換
- TI推出12位125-MSPS數據轉換器AD
- Micrel發布用于以太網光纖的五端口轉換器
推薦技術資料
- DS2202型示波器試用
- 說起數字示波器,普源算是國內的老牌子了,FQP8N60... [詳細]